Random embedded images missing from Confluence documents (after update?)

boris11 January 24, 2018

We've noticed that a handful of random images have gone missing from our Confluence documents. The image shows up with a broken link icon. When clicking the image, it takes you to a blank overlay with the following URL at the top:

 

http://server:8080/download/attachments/8618173/image2017-4-19%2014%3A33%3A11.png?version=1&modificationDate=1492630391352&api=v2

 

Is there a way to recover images?

Check the file permissions on the Confluence home directory. It's probably easiest to just change ownership on the entire home directory structure to be owned by the user that Confluence runs as. If Confluence was running with a privileged user at some point in its life and now is running as an unprivileged user, you may see this sort of behavior.

If that isn't it, I'd recommend opening an Atlassian Support issue. Attachments don't just disappear during an upgrade normally, so something bad may have happened.
